Claremore - Joseph Noel Franklin "Joe" Henderson
A memorial service to remember and celebrate the life of Joseph Noel Franklin Henderson will be 3:00 p.m. Wednesday, October 29, 2025, in the chapel at DeLozier Funeral Service. Joe left his temporary earthly home for his permanent heavenly home on Wednesday, October 22, 2025, surrounded by his family. He was 89 years old.
Born in Tulsa, OK on May 18, 1936, to Prince Albert "PA" and Helen Elizabeth (Mallory) Henderson. Joe was raised and educated in the Oologah area and attended Oologah Public Schools. He continued his education at Tulsa Welding School. Joe faithfully served his country in the United States Army, where he received his honorable discharge. In 1963, Joe married the love of his life Carol Casey, and they became a blended family with 4 children, Randy,Janet, Ginger, and Joe Jr. Joe provided for his family with a lifetime career in pipeline welding. He was a member of the Pipeliners Local 798 for 67 years.
According to his family Joe liked to work, because he loved to weld. He did though have many other interests and hobbies. Joe knew his way around the kitchen and was quite the chef. It was because of this that he and wife Carol started a very successful business in Claremore, Cotton Eyed Joe's BBQ. They then moved to Noel, MO in 1985 and opened up another Cotton Eyed Joe's restaurant. Joe liked people and enjoyed a good conversation; this contributed to the success of his business. His daughter Ginger said that if her dad was your friend he was a good one. Joe and Carol both liked being outside and enjoyed yard work. You only had to drive by their house to see the fruits of their labor.
Ten years ago, Joe's son-in-law (Joe Erwin), had the honor of leading his father-in-law to Christ at the age of 79. It was life changing for both Joes and it made possible for the family to know that he and Carol are now together for eternity. If Joe could say anything to his family and friends, it would be to accept the gift of eternal life that God has so freely given.
Joe has left a legacy that will live on in the lives of his family and friends. He is survived by his children, Ginger Erin and husband Joe, Joe Henderson Jr., Randy Willis and wife Rhonda, Janet Hayes, and Molly the pooch. Joe was Papa Joe to numerous grandchildren, great grandchildren and 1 great great grandson, brother, Raymond Henderson and wife Beverly, Kirk Koster a young man Joe considered to be another son, and numerous nieces, nephews, cousins, and extended family, Joe was preceded in death by his wife of 61 years Carol, grandsons, Tyler and Dustin Dost, sister, Lydia Henderson, brother, Melton Henderson and his wife Thelma, and son-in-law, Mike Hayes.
